Cold Weather Advisory
Issued: 12:37 PM Jan. 6, 2026 – National Weather Service
...COLD WEATHER ADVISORY IN EFFECT FROM 6 PM WEDNESDAY TO 6 PM AKST SATURDAY... * WHAT...Very cold wind chills as low as -40 to -55. For Pilot Point and Port Heiden, very cold wind chills as low as -30 to -45. * WHERE...Lower Kuskokwim Valley, Kuskokwim Delta, Western Capes, Bristol Bay, and Northern and Central Alaska Peninsula. * WHEN...From 6 PM Wednesday to 6 PM AKST Saturday. * IMPACTS...The dangerously cold wind chills as low as 55 below zero could cause frostbite on exposed skin in as little as 5 minutes.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Air temperatures will steadily drop through Wednesday night, reaching as low as -30 to -40 degrees. Beginning Wednesday evening, sustained winds as high as 20-30 mph will bring widespread areas of frigid wind chills, with the potential for wind chills to -55 or lower. Confidence is low for when this cold air outbreak will end, as there is a chance that bitterly cold conditions could continue through early next week.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... Use caution while traveling outside. Wear appropriate clothing, a hat, and gloves. Reduce time outdoors if possible. &&
